引言 比特币,无疑是当前金融市场中最受关注和最具争议的数字货币之一。由于其价格波动性大,以及全球范围内投...
区块链是一种去中心化的分布式账本技术。简单来说,它是由多个数据块组成的链式结构,每个数据块包含了多个交易记录,并通过密码学技术连接在一起,形成一个不可篡改的账本。
区块链的工作原理可以归纳为以下几个关键步骤: 1. 数据块的生成:每个数据块中包含多个交易记录以及上一块的哈希值。 2. 数据块的验证:通过算法和网络共识机制验证数据块是否有效,并将其加入到链中。 3. 数据块的链接:将新的数据块的哈希值与上一块的哈希值连接在一起,形成一个不可篡改的链。 4. 分布式存储:数据块被复制存储在网络中的多个节点,实现去中心化和容错性。
区块链具有以下几个显著特点: 1. 去中心化:没有中央机构控制,数据由网络中的各个节点共同维护和验证。 2. 透明性:所有的交易记录都被公开记录在账本中,任何人都可以查看,提高了交易的可信度。 3. 不可篡改性:一旦数据被写入区块链,就很难修改或删除,保证了数据的完整性和安全性。 4. 高安全性:通过密码学算法和共识机制确保了区块链的安全性,不易被攻击或篡改。 5. 快速的交易速度:使用区块链进行交易可以实现快速、近实时的交易确认和结算。
区块链技术具有广泛的应用前景,特别是在以下领域: 1. 加密货币:区块链的首个应用就是比特币,而现在还涌现出许多其他的加密货币,如以太坊、莱特币等。 2. 供应链管理:通过区块链技术可以实现全程透明的供应链管理,有效追踪商品来源和品质。 3. 版权保护:区块链可以提供去中心化的版权保护,确保数字内容的产权归属和交易安全。 4. 金融服务:区块链可以实现去中介化的金融服务,如智能合约、跨境支付等。 5. 身份认证:基于区块链的身份认证系统能够提高信息安全和个人隐私保护。
区块链的优势包括: 1. 去中心化和防篡改的特性确保了数据的安全性和可靠性。 2. 减少中间环节,实现低成本的交易和服务。 3. 提高了透明度和可验证性,增加了交易的信任度。 4. 为创新提供了空间,促进了分布式应用的发展。 区块链面临的挑战包括: 1. 扩展性当交易量增加时,区块链的性能和扩展性可能会受到限制。 2. 法律和监管区块链的去中心化特性可能与现行的法律和监管制度冲突。 3. 隐私和安全区块链中的交易记录是公开可见的,如何保护用户的隐私和数据安全是一个挑战。 4. 技术标准和互操作性目前区块链技术还没有达成统一的标准和互操作性,限制了应用的发展。